Byo KFC opens 24 hours weekends

KFC

Whinsley Masara, Chronicle Reporter
INTERNATIONAL fast food chain Kentucky Fried Chicken (KFC) which opened doors in Bulawayo two months ago, has since gone 24-hour through its Drive-Thru point.

The Drive Thru restaurant located at the Bradfield Shopping Centre, opened nine weeks ago in the city of Bulawayo and has been highly embraced. This, according to management, has led them to quickly make the decision to open shop 24 hours on weekends when demand is very high.The restaurant used to close at 10PM.

A KFC Zimbabwe official said: “KFC is well known for its Drive-Thru experience, something we’ve introduced to our customers in Zimbabwe.

“We know that our customers enjoy the convenience of extended hours on Fridays and Saturdays and we’re happy to be able to offer a 24-hour service to the Bulawayo community.”

The spokesperson thanked the Bulawayo community for embracing the fast food outlet.

“We’re so excited about how well the restaurant has been received. We’ve been really busy and our sales have been outstandingly great and continue to increase since we opened the restaurant.”

Streetwise 2 has been the most popular meal with the Krushers also gaining popularity.

“We’ve been operating at Bradfield, Bulawayo for just over nine weeks and we’ll continue to introduce new concepts as we progress,” she said.

KFC Bulawayo is the fifth branch of the American brand which is being franchised in Zimbabwe by Crispy Chicken Restaurants (Pvt) Limited. — @winnie_masara
